The global biosolids market is expected to be worth US$ 1.7 billion in 2023, with a CAGR of 4.6% to reach US$ 2.7 billion by the end of 2033.
The biosolids market has evolved significantly in recent years, influenced by a multitude of factors that underscore its dynamic nature. Biosolids, a byproduct of wastewater treatment processes, have found diverse applications in agriculture, horticulture, and soil improvement.

Competitive Landscape
The biosolids market features a high degree of fragmentation, with numerous players making substantial investments in research and development to enhance biosolid quality, meeting the specific needs of end-users. A group of prominent market players contributes approximately 30-32% of the global market value. These investments predominantly focus on formulating innovative techniques and applications to expand the utilization of biosolids across various end-use sectors.
Furthermore, market participants are embracing innovative strategies, including forging joint ventures with local research institutions to devise cost-effective production methods.
For example, in July 2022, Phoenixville, in collaboration with its partner SoMax BioEnergy, introduced a significant innovation for the advantageous use of biosolids. Their joint venture explores a novel hydrothermal carbonization conversion technology, offering an alternative to digestion by converting biosolids into energy-dense hydro-char fuel. This highlights the industry's commitment to driving progress through collaboration and innovative solutions.
